Materials and techniques | woodcut, ink on paper |
Brief description | Print by Utagawa Kunisada depicting a kabuki actor in role, mid 19th c. Harry Beard Collection. |
Physical description | Woodcut coloured print by Utagawa Kunisada depicting a kabuki actor in role. The figure stands in a fightling pose. |
